Build Strong Promotional Marketing Campaigns
Start with a clear plan. Define your target audience and what you want to achieve. Set specific goals like increasing brand awareness, driving sales, or launching a new product. Choose promotional products that fit your brand and appeal to your audience.
Key steps:
Identify your audience’s needs and preferences
Select products that match your brand identity
Set measurable goals and deadlines
Plan distribution channels (events, mail, online)
Track results and adjust as needed
For example, if you want to boost brand awareness at a trade show, choose eye-catching items like custom tote bags or water bottles. These keep your brand visible long after the event.

What is a promotional strategy in marketing?
A promotional strategy is a plan to communicate your brand’s value to customers. It uses various tools like advertising, sales promotions, public relations, and direct marketing. The goal is to influence buying decisions and build loyalty.
In promotional marketing campaigns, the strategy focuses on using branded products to create a lasting impression. These products act as tangible reminders of your brand. They increase customer engagement and encourage repeat business.
Examples of promotional strategies:
Giveaways at events to attract attention
Loyalty rewards with branded merchandise
Seasonal promotions with limited-edition items
Cross-promotions with partner businesses
Each strategy should align with your overall marketing goals. Use data to refine your approach and maximize impact.

Choose the Right Promotional Products
Selecting the right products is critical. The items must be useful, high quality, and relevant to your audience. Avoid cheap giveaways that get discarded quickly. Instead, pick items that customers will keep and use regularly.
Tips for choosing products:
Match products to your audience’s lifestyle
Use items that showcase your logo clearly
Consider product durability and usefulness
Stay within your budget without sacrificing quality
Think about seasonal relevance and trends
Popular choices include drinkware, tech gadgets, apparel, and office supplies. Customization options like color, design, and packaging add extra appeal.

Implement and Track Your Campaign
Execution is where plans turn into results. Distribute your promotional products strategically. Use events, direct mail, online orders, or in-store giveaways. Make sure your brand message is consistent across all channels.
Track key performance indicators (KPIs) such as:
Number of products distributed
Customer engagement rates
Website traffic increases
Sales growth linked to the campaign
Social media mentions and shares
Use surveys or feedback forms to gather customer opinions. Analyze data regularly to identify what works and what needs improvement.
